Etymology edit

From Old High German Nordhūsa, Nordhūse, Northūsun (literally northern houses). By surface analysis, Nord +‎ -hausen.

Proper noun edit

Nordhausen n (proper noun, genitive Nordhausens or (optionally with an article) Nordhausen)

  1. A town and rural district of Thuringia
  2. Nordhouse (a commune of the Bas-Rhin department, Grand Est, France)
